Phoenix, fresh from success at last weekend's Golden Globes ceremony and tipped for an Oscar nod this Monday, spoke at a rally before the protest, underlining his own specific support regarding climate emergency.
"Sometimes we wonder what can we do in this fight against climate change, and there is something that you can do today and tomorrow, by making a choice about what you consume," the 45-year-old said.
"There are things I can’t avoid. I flew a plane here today, or last night rather, but one thing I can do is change my eating habits."
